Materials and Symbolism in Wind Chimes
Most spiritual wind chimes are made from bamboo, metal, or ceramic. Each material carries its own vibration and symbolism:
- Bamboo: Represents nature, simplicity, and the flow of qi. It produces soft, earthy sounds ideal for grounding practices.
- Metal: Associated with clarity, strength, and high resonance. Perfect for chakra alignment and sound healing work.
- Ceramic: Symbolizes fragility, elegance, and spiritual refinement, offering delicate tones with artistic beauty.
The choice of material can subtly influence the mood and intention of your meditation space.

Where to Place a Meditation Wind Chime
Thoughtful placement enhances the chime’s spiritual effect. Ideal spots include:
- Near a window where a gentle breeze passes
- In your outdoor meditation garden or zen corner
- In a yoga or sound healing room
- At the entrance of your sacred space, to mark transitions

1. Are meditation wind chimes only for outdoor use?
Not at all. While many people hang them in gardens or balconies, meditation wind chimes are equally effective indoors — near a window, in a yoga room, or meditation corner.
2. Do meditation wind chimes need wind to produce sound?
Traditionally yes, but you can also gently tap or swing them by hand during practice for intentional sound use.

9. Do meditation wind chimes need special maintenance?
Just occasional dusting and checking for tangles or weather wear if outdoors. Bamboo or metal chimes may benefit from light oiling.
10. Can I use more than one wind chime in a space?
Yes. You can layer chimes with different tones and materials to create a harmonious soundscape — just avoid overwhelming the space.
